The VFC110BG from Texas Instruments is a high-performance, monolithic voltage-to-frequency converter (VFC) that offers unparalleled flexibility and precision for a wide array of applications. This device is designed to convert an analog voltage input into a frequency output, making it an essential component for systems requiring digital representation of analog signals.
Key Features:
- Wide Dynamic Range: The VFC110BG is capable of handling a broad range of input voltages, ensuring versatility in various application environments.
- High Linearity: With its precision design, the device maintains excellent linearity, minimizing errors and enhancing overall system accuracy.
- Low Power Consumption: Engineered for efficiency, the VFC110BG operates with minimal power requirements, making it suitable for battery-powered and portable applications.
- Adjustable Full-Scale Frequency: Users can set the full-scale output frequency with external components, allowing customization for specific application needs.
- Wide Supply Range: The device is functional over a broad supply voltage range, accommodating various power supply standards.

Technical Specifications:
Parameter
Value
Package Type
8-Pin DIP
Operating Temperature
-25°C to +85°C
Supply Voltage Range
±4.5V to ±18V
Full-Scale Frequency
Adjustable with external components
Nonlinearity
±0.01% (typical)
